How can parents ensure the safety of their child in a vehicle by correctly using a booster seat?

Parents can ensure their child's safety in a vehicle by correctly using a booster seat, which is designed to elevate the child so that the seat belt fits properly. This includes making sure the booster seat is the right size for the child, installing it securely in the back seat, and ensuring the seat belt is positioned correctly across the child's chest and hips. Regularly checking the fit and condition of the booster seat is also important to ensure maximum safety.

Does a booster seat require a latch system for proper installation and safety?

No, a booster seat does not require a latch system for proper installation and safety. Booster seats are designed to be used with a vehicle's seat belt to properly secure a child in the seat.

Do backless booster seats need to be anchored for safety purposes?

No, backless booster seats do not need to be anchored for safety purposes. They are designed to be used with the vehicle's seat belt system to properly secure the child in the seat.
